Inter are interested in signing Napoli star Lorenzo Insigne but will have to cough up at least €70 million if they wish to sign him according to a report from Corriere dello Sport.

Insigne has been linked with a move to the Nerazzurri a few times in recent months and if an offer of around the above amount were to arrive this Summer, Napoli officials would certainly think about it.

The possible arrivals of both James Rodriguez and Hirving Lozano at Napoli could have an affect on Insigne at Partenopei.

Insigne has been on Napoli’s books since 2006 and he has donned the famous sky blue shirt of Napoli on no less than 305 occasions.

The Italian international is under contract with the Stadio San Paolo side, who he captains, until the end of the 2021/22 season.

This past season he made a total of 41 appearances across all competitions in which he scored 14 and tallied six assists.
